Hot-Work Tool Steel

Chemical composition(mass fraction)(wt.%)

Elements Min.(≥) Max.(≤) Similar Remarks
C 0.50  0.60
Si 0.80  1.00
Mn 0.50  0.70
Cr 7.00  7.50
Mo  
V  
W 7.00  7.50
